Introduction to GCP Architecture

Inquire now

Duration 5 days – 35 hrs

 

Overview

The Introduction to Google Cloud Platform (GCP) Architecture Training Course is designed to provide participants with a solid foundation in the principles and practices of architecting solutions on GCP. This course covers the core services, tools, and best practices needed to design, build, and manage scalable and secure applications on the Google Cloud Platform. Through a mix of theoretical instruction and hands-on labs, participants will gain practical experience and insights into using GCP effectively.

 

Objectives

• Understand GCP Fundamentals: Learn the basic concepts and components of Google Cloud Platform, including its global infrastructure and core services.
• Explore Core GCP Services: Gain knowledge of essential GCP services such as Compute Engine, Cloud Storage, BigQuery, and Cloud Networking.
• Design Scalable Architectures: Learn best practices for designing scalable, high-performance, and resilient architectures on GCP.
• Implement Security Best Practices: Understand how to secure GCP resources using Identity and Access Management (IAM), encryption, and network security.
• Cost Management and Optimization: Learn strategies for managing and optimizing costs on GCP.
• Hands-On Experience: Participate in labs and exercises to apply the concepts learned and gain practical experience with GCP services.

 

Audience

• Aspiring GCP Solutions Architects: Individuals aiming to start a career as a Google Cloud Platform Solutions Architect.
• IT Professionals and Engineers: Those working in IT who want to gain foundational knowledge of GCP and cloud architecture.
• System Administrators: IT administrators looking to transition from on-premises infrastructure to cloud-based solutions.
• Developers: Software developers seeking to understand how to deploy and manage applications on the GCP platform.
• Network Engineers: Professionals focused on networking who want to learn about GCP’s networking services and capabilities.
• Database Administrators: DBAs interested in managing and optimizing databases in the cloud.
• Project Managers: Managers overseeing cloud projects who need to understand GCP services and architecture.
• IT Consultants: Consultants advising clients on cloud adoption and architecture who need to understand GCP fundamentals.
• Recent Graduates: Individuals who have recently completed a degree in IT, computer science, or related fields and want to gain practical cloud skills.
• Tech Enthusiasts: Anyone with a general interest in learning about Google Cloud Platform and its applications in modern IT environments.

 

Prerequisites

• Basic IT Knowledge: Understanding of fundamental IT concepts and terminology.
• Familiarity with Cloud Computing: General awareness of cloud computing principles and benefits.
• Basic Networking Knowledge: Basic understanding of networking concepts and protocols.
• No Prior GCP Experience Required: The course is designed for beginners with no previous GCP experience.

 

Course Content

Basic Course: Introduction to GCP Architecture

Section 1: Introduction to Cloud Architecture

• Understanding Cloud Computing: Basic concepts and benefits of cloud computing on GCP.
• Introduction to GCP: Overview of GCP services related to computing, storage, networking, and security.

 

Section 2: Core GCP Services

• Compute Engine Basics: Introduction to VMs and basic configurations.
• Cloud Storage Fundamentals: Understanding object, file, and block storage options.
• Basic Networking: Setting up VPCs, and subnets, and understanding GCP’s global network.

 

Section 3: Basic Security and Compliance

• Fundamental Security Practices: Basic identity and access management (IAM), roles, and permissions.
• Compliance Overview: Understanding the importance of compliance in the cloud.

 

Section 4: Managing GCP Environments

• Using GCP Console and Cloud SDK: Basic navigation and simple commands.
• Introduction to Billing and Cost Management: Understanding costs, budgets, and alerts.

 

Section 5: Hands-On Labs and Simple Case Studies

• Deploying a Simple Web Application: Using App Engine or Compute Engine.
• Basic Data Movement: Importing data into Cloud Storage.

Inquire now

Best selling courses

Duration 3 days – 21 hrs   Overview    This Portfolio Management Training Course is designed to provide banking professionals with a comprehensive understanding of how to effectively manage investment...

Duration 2 days – 14 hrs   Overview   This comprehensive Planning and Forecasting Training Course is designed to empower professionals with the tools and techniques necessary to accurately predict...

Duration 2 days – 14 hrs   Overview   This hands-on course provides an introduction to Splunk, a powerful platform for searching, monitoring, and analyzing machine-generated data. The training focuses...

Duration 3 days – 21 hrs   Overview.   This course is designed for fresh graduates aspiring to build a career in Data Science. It introduces the fundamentals of data...

Among the most popular and widely implemented NoSQL databases is MongoDB. Its scalability, robustness, and flexibility have made it extremely popular among the Fortune 500 and Global 500 companies who use it to implement a variety of activities including social communications, analytics, content management, archiving, and other activities.

PROGRAMMING / CODING

ASP.NET

SP.NET is a framework for developing dynamic web applications. It supports languages like VB.Net, C#, Jscript.Net, etc. The programming logic and content can be developed separately in Microsoft Asp.Net.

CYBER SECURITY

Physical Security

Duration 3 days – 21 hrs   Overview   This course provides a comprehensive introduction to physical security principles, policies, technologies, and practices. It covers methods to assess physical risks,...

Duration 5 days – 35 hrs   Overview   This intensive 5-day course is designed for professionals seeking advanced-level skills in Microsoft SQL Server’s BI stack: SSRS (SQL Server Reporting...

We use cookies on our website to personalize your experience by storing your preferences and recognizing repeat visits. By clicking “Accept”, you agree to the use of all cookies. You can also select “Cookie Settings” to adjust your preferences and provide more specific consent. Cookie Policy